Screenshots look inconsistent and risk leaking sensitive info. A cross-platform, open-source desktop app captures, beautifies, annotates, and exports high-quality images locally (no telemetry), with pro presets and on-device AI planned.
Polished, privacy-first local screenshot editing for professionals targets a $18.0B = 500M knowledge workers x $36/year avg spend on productivity / visual-communication tools total addressable market with medium saturation and a year-over-year growth rate of 12% CAGR estimated for visual-communication and productivity tooling.
Key trends driving demand: Async remote work -- more reliance on screenshots for documentation and communication increases demand for polished visuals.; Privacy & local-first computing -- users and companies avoid cloud uploads/telemetry for sensitive screenshots.; On-device ML acceleration -- modern CPUs/NPUs enable background removal and enhancement locally without cloud costs.; Open-source adoption -- organizations prefer auditable tools to avoid vendor lock-in and reduce procurement friction..
Key competitors include TechSmith — Snagit, CleanShot X, ShareX, Markup Hero.
